Output 18ed14dce731501a89543afa03443fb0be20f5a1a285610008ab02cc7765efa3:21

value
649000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2501f486020715341b974b74d6197534c423a27e OP_EQUALVERIFY OP_CHECKSIG
address
14NgLwq1HsBjJt8iyrGtN5RYSKJ4eGYYzj
transaction
18ed14dce731501a89543afa03443fb0be20f5a1a285610008ab02cc7765efa3
spent
true